The fraction is the plain dimensionless ratio, running from 0 to 1, where percent runs from 0 to 100. One fraction is exactly 100 percent, and the factor of 100 is exact by definition. It is the form that belongs inside equations, since a formula expecting a fraction will silently give an answer a hundred times too large if fed a percentage.
Watch out: Efficiency, relative humidity and blowdown ratios are all quoted as percentages in conversation and used as fractions in arithmetic. Mixing the two is the most common dimensionless-unit error there is, and it is invisible in the units because both are dimensionless.
